2026 Application Fees and Expected Timelines
The administrative fee for a Russian citizen applying for an Albania e-visa in 2026 is 60 Euro (approximately 6,000 RUB depending on market rates). This fee is required for processing and is non-refundable. The payment link is generated after the initial biographical data boxes are verified by the system. Given the current 2026 security protocols, processing can take between 15 and 25 working days. We recommend initiating your application at least 50 days before your flight. Technical Field Breakdown: Filling the Digital Boxes
The 2026 online form requires precise English (Latin alphabet) entries. Here is how to handle the most important input fields:
Field Set 1: Biographical Identification
Surname and Given Names: Enter these exactly as they appear in the Latin-script (English) section of your Russian international passport. Do not use Cyrillic characters in any box.
Place of Birth: This box must match the "Place of Birth" listed on your passport's bio-data page (e.g., USSR or RUSSIA).
Nationality at Birth: Select "Russian Federation" to trigger the specific 2026 protocol for your passport type.
Field Set 2: Passport and Travel Validity
Passport Number Input: Type the alphanumeric series and number without spaces or the "№" symbol.
Expiry Date Box: Albania requires your passport to be valid for at least 6 months after your intended departure date.
Visa Type Selection: For tourism or short-term visits, select "Type C - Short Stay."
Field Set 3: Host and Lodging Information
The 2026 portal is highly sensitive to your lodging details:
Host/Hotel Name Box: Type the full registered name of your hotel or the name of your Albanian host.
Albanian Phone Number: A local (+355) contact number is mandatory. Use the hotel’s verified reception number.
Physical Address: Provide the complete street address in Albania, including the city (e.g., Tirana, Vlorë, or Sarandë).
2026 Mandatory Digital Uploads for Russians
Once the text fields are completed, the system moves to the "Evidence" tab. For Russian citizens, the 2026 standards require:
The 12-Month Financial Box: You must upload a scanned PDF bank statement covering the last full year. The system looks for a consistent balance that can cover at least 50 Euro per day of stay.
Professional Proof: Upload your employment certificate (stating your position and salary) or business registration in the "Occupational Status" field.
Logistics: Upload your confirmed round-trip flight itinerary and hotel vouchers. Ensure the dates match the "Trip Information" boxes exactly.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I pay the 60 Euro fee with a Russian-issued Mir or Visa/Mastercard?
In 2026, most Russian-issued bank cards are not accepted by the Albanian government's payment gateway. You will likely need to use a card issued in a third country (e.g., Turkey, Kazakhstan, or UAE) or a card enabled for international Euro transactions to ensure the payment clears.
Does a valid Schengen visa waive the requirement?
If you hold a valid, multiple-entry Schengen, UK, or USA visa that has already been used once, you may be exempt from the visa requirement. However, in 2026, it is mandatory to enter these details into the "Other Visas" box in the portal to confirm your status before travel.
How is the e-visa delivered?
The approved visa is sent as a PDF via email. In 2026, you must print a high-quality physical copy of this e-visa to present at both the airport in Russia and the Albanian border. Digital versions on mobile devices are often not sufficient.
Final Review Step
The final page of the portal is the "Review Summary." Check the Passport Number and Dates of Stay boxes one last time. In 2026, errors in these fields cannot be corrected once the fee is paid, and will lead to a lost application.
